A13 JUB is a 2012 Honda Jazz in Black with a 1,339c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 90.9%.
Across all 2012 Honda Jazz models, the average MOT pass rate is 86.0% with a typical mileage of 41,291 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Honda Jazz f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 57,414 recorded failures. If you're considering buying A13 JUB,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Honda Jazz typically stays on UK roads for around 24 years. At 14 years old, this Honda Jazz is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
